Category B Full Irish Driving Licence
A full Irish driving licence in category B allows you to operate cars and certain types of light commercial vehicles. To get hold of a category B licence, you'll need to pass both a theory test and a practical driving examination. The theory test assesses your knowledge of road laws, while the practical driving test evaluates your ability to effectively manage a vehicle on the road.

Category B Driving Licence Requirements in Ireland
To obtain a Category B driving licence in Ireland, you'll require certain criteria. Firstly, you must attain the minimum age of 17 years old. You will also require to successfully complete both a written assessment and a practical driving evaluation.
To prepare for the examinations, you can undertake driver training from a registered driving instructor. They will teach you on the rules of the road and develop your driving proficiency.
